Alaskan Cruise Destinations
Alaska is a paradise for nature lovers and adventure seekers, offering a unique cruise experience unlike any other. The appeal of Alaskan cruise destinations lies in the stunning landscapes, abundant wildlife, and awe-inspiring natural wonders that captivate passengers on their voyage.
Wildlife and Natural Wonders of Alaska
Alaska is home to a diverse range of wildlife, including majestic bald eagles, humpback whales, grizzly bears, and playful sea otters. Passengers on an Alaskan cruise have the opportunity to witness these incredible creatures in their natural habitats, creating unforgettable memories.
The natural wonders of Alaska are equally impressive, with towering glaciers, snow-capped mountains, and pristine fjords dotting the landscape. The famous Glacier Bay National Park allows cruisers to witness the dramatic calving of glaciers and hear the thunderous roar as ice crashes into the sea.
Popular Choice for Cruise Enthusiasts
Alaska has become a popular choice for cruise enthusiasts seeking a unique and immersive travel experience. The chance to explore remote wilderness areas, witness breathtaking scenery, and engage with indigenous cultures makes an Alaskan cruise a once-in-a-lifetime adventure.
Whether you’re cruising through the Inside Passage, visiting the charming port towns of Ketchikan and Juneau, or marveling at the Hubbard Glacier, an Alaskan cruise offers something for every traveler. With its combination of natural beauty and wildlife encounters, it’s no wonder Alaska is a top destination for those looking to embark on an unforgettable voyage.

Seasonal Cruise Destinations
When it comes to cruising, timing can make a significant difference in your overall experience. Certain destinations shine during specific seasons, offering unique advantages and experiences that cater to different preferences. Exploring seasonal cruise destinations allows you to witness the best of each location at the ideal time.
Caribbean Cruise Destinations
The Caribbean is a popular cruise destination with peak seasons typically falling between December to April. During this time, you can expect pleasant weather with minimal rainfall, ideal for enjoying the region’s stunning beaches and vibrant culture. Cruise lines like Royal Caribbean and Carnival offer a variety of itineraries to explore different Caribbean islands during these peak months.
Alaskan Cruise Destinations
Alaska is best visited during the summer months from May to September when the weather is milder, and wildlife sightings are abundant. Cruise lines such as Princess Cruises and Holland America Line excel in providing immersive experiences, including glacier viewing and wildlife excursions, during the peak season in Alaska.
Mediterranean Cruise Destinations
The Mediterranean region is perfect for cruising from April to October when the weather is warm and ideal for exploring historic cities and picturesque coastal towns. Cruise lines like MSC Cruises and Celebrity Cruises offer diverse itineraries that showcase the rich cultural heritage of destinations like Italy, Greece, and Spain during the peak season.
South Pacific Cruise Destinations
The South Pacific is best visited from June to August when the weather is dry and perfect for enjoying water activities like snorkeling and diving. Cruise lines such as Paul Gauguin Cruises and Windstar Cruises provide intimate experiences in destinations like Tahiti and Fiji during their peak season, offering exclusive excursions to remote islands.
European River Cruise Destinations
European river cruises are ideal during the spring and fall months when the weather is mild, and the landscapes are beautifully adorned with blooming flowers or autumn foliage. River cruise lines like Viking River Cruises and Avalon Waterways offer scenic journeys along iconic rivers like the Rhine and Danube, allowing passengers to explore charming towns and historic sites at a leisurely pace.
Asian Cruise Destinations
Asia’s cruise destinations are best visited during the fall and winter months when the weather is cooler and more comfortable for exploring bustling cities and ancient temples. Cruise lines such as Princess Cruises and Royal Caribbean offer itineraries to exotic destinations like Japan, Vietnam, and Thailand during their peak seasons, providing unique cultural experiences and culinary delights.
Expedition Cruise Destinations
Expedition cruises to destinations like Antarctica and the Galapagos Islands are best experienced during their respective peak seasons, typically during the summer months for Antarctica and year-round for the Galapagos Islands. Cruise lines like Hurtigruten and Lindblad Expeditions specialize in providing immersive adventures in these remote and pristine locations, offering opportunities for wildlife encounters and exploration of unique ecosystems.
